Define Your Scope
It is crucial to establish your main goal before you begin to build your link collection. This will help you determine how your collection will look and be organized. If you're collecting information related to digital marketing, as an instance, your collection might be organized by topic or by type of material. You can also use tags to add another layer of organization which allows users to locate sources quickly and easily.

The Link Collection List microcontent type is designed for carefully curated lists of external links that can be used to complement the library's content. This is a great solution when the automatic generation of lists doesn't work or you require more control over the order of your list and presentation. The Admin view for this microcontent type includes filters and sort options to manually arrange and present the content. Contact your Firstup Support team for more details about this premium feature.
